Stand-up comedian Mohamed Salem will perform at ROOM Art Space, followed by music by acoustic guitarist and singer Shady Ahmed.
Mohamed Salem started performing stand-up comedy in Alexandria, and in 2008 moved to Cairo.
In 2009 Salem won the award for Best Comedian in the Middle East at the Amman Comedians Festival.
Salem had previously appeared on Moga Standup programme in 2010, the TV show aired on Moga Comedy Channel which was the first to present Arabic stand-up comedy.
Salem has performed internationally in six different Arab countries, as well as taking part in group stand-up shows with renowned comedians including Russell Peters, Maz Jobrani, Ahmed Ahmed and Dean Edwards.
Shady Ahmed is a singer and guitarist. His debut album titled Life Is Hard For Those Who Dream was self-produced and brought together a collection of studio-recorded songs of his audience’s favourites.
Ahmed started as the front man for Kravin and The 19th Band, two Cairo-based Rock N’Roll bands.
His current band, The Downtown Meltdown includes guitarist Tarek Abdulkawi, Mokhtar El-Sayeh and Magued Nagaty.
